‘One Dive Family’ lines up under SDI banner

International Training has restructured its diver-training agencies under the Scuba Diving International (SDI) name, creating what it calls the “One Dive Family.” This merger includes TDI (Technical Diving International), ERDI (Emergency Response Diving International), and PFI (Performance Freediving International), along with SDI’s recreational diving services. The Raja Ampat Creature Feature Series Anemone Shrimp

The Glass Anemone Shrimp, or Peacock-Tail Anemone Shrimp, is a small and colorful creature found in Raja Ampat’s coral reefs. Its transparent body is decorated with vibrant hues like blue, purple, and yellow, making it popular among macro photographers. Scubapro becomes BSAC Kit Partner

Scubapro has become the official kit partner for the British Sub-Aqua Club (BSAC). This partnership will enhance safety and training for divers in the UK. Scubapro’s top-quality diving equipment will support BSAC’s mission to promote safe diving practices and training. Let’s Go to The Zoo

The Zoo, a dive site near Wakatobi, is perfect for everyone, including new divers and families. With short boat rides and calm ocean conditions, it offers diverse depths suitable for both divers and snorkelers. DON’T BELIEVE THE EYES

In diving, it’s important to remember that not everything is as it seems underwater. Some fish, like the signal goby, have deceptive markings that make them look larger or more intimidating.
